Role Overview:

The Source and Recruit Company is excited to assist our client, JOA, in their search for a dedicated R&D Electrical Engineer. This role is integral to the Research and Development team, offering hands-on technical assistance in all aspects of new product design, development, testing, and documentation. This is a chance to contribute to the cutting-edge of industrial automation equipment design, with a focus on electrical systems.

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ate on the comprehensive design of industrial automation equipment, with a focus on optimizing electrical systems.
  • Develop and implement control programs for electric components, enhancing the functionality of PLC, HMI, motion, and message display systems.
  • Design electrical component schematic drawings, panel layouts, and generate detailed Bill of Materials (BOMs).
  • Deploy and manage measurement systems for accurate data collection, utilizing a variety of sensors and devices.
  • Apply statistical analysis to data, identifying trends and drawing actionable conclusions.
  • Ensure effective knowledge transfer through clear, concise documentation and communication.

Occasional Responsibilities:

  • Maintenance and upgrading of test equipment.
  • Assistance with equipment assembly.
  • Application of object-oriented programming principles.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or a related discipline, or equivalent training and experience.
  • 0-5 years of experience in engineering design, preferably with converting equipment.
  • Proficiency in oral and written communication.
  • Skilled in the use of hand tools, electronic measuring devices, and computer software, including PLC and motion control, 3D and 2D CAD programs, Microsoft Office, and statistical analysis tools.

Physical Requirements:

  • Comfort with a full day of computer work.
  • Ability to lift objects up to 25 pounds.
  • Willingness to work in environments that may be loud and unconditioned during machine commissioning.
  • Ability to wear personal protective equipment as required.
  • Open to international and domestic travel, up to 20%.
